Word Fluency
The ability to rapidly retrieve words from memory, often tested by asking individuals to produce as many words as possible from a category in a limited time.
Fluid Intelligence
The aspect of intelligence involved in the ability to think abstractly, reason quickly, and solve problems in novel situations, independent of acquired knowledge.
Quick Reasoning
The ability to think and form judgments rapidly and efficiently.
Correlational Research
A type of non-experimental research method used to measure the extent to which two variables are related, without implying causation.
